How much do events host j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 24, 2026, the average hourly pay for events host in the United States is $18.19,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.18 and $19.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an event host do?

An event host is responsible for welcoming guests, guiding event activities, and ensuring attendees have a positive experience. They often coordinate with staff, manage schedules, and may use tools like scripts or event management software to facilitate smooth proceedings.

What are some common challenges faced by an Events Host, and how can they be managed effectively?

Events Hosts often encounter challenges such as last-minute changes to the event schedule, managing diverse guest expectations, and coordinating with multiple vendors or team members under tight timelines. Successful hosts stay adaptable, communicate clearly with all stakeholders, and maintain a calm, solutions-focused attitude. Building strong relationships with venue staff and suppliers, as well as having contingency plans in place, can help ensure smooth event execution and guest satisfaction.

What is the difference between Events Host vs Event Coordinator?

AspectEvents HostEvent Coordinator
CredentialsNone specific, often requires good communication skillsEvent planning certifications or experience often preferred
Work EnvironmentLive events, parties, entertainment venuesOff-site planning, logistics, and organization
Employer & Industry UsageEntertainment, hospitality, event venuesCorporate, non-profit, wedding planning, event management firms

While both roles involve events, an Events Host primarily engages with guests during the event, ensuring entertainment and interaction. An Event Coordinator handles planning, logistics, and coordination before and after the event. The Events Host focuses on guest experience, whereas the Event Coordinator manages the overall event execution.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Events Host,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Events Host, you need excellent interpersonal skills, organizational abilities, and experience in event coordination, often supported by a background in hospitality or communications. Familiarity with event management software, scheduling tools, and audio-visual equipment is typically required. Strong soft skills such as adaptability, charisma, and effective communication help create memorable guest experiences and smoothly handle unexpected situations. These skills ensure events run seamlessly, guests are engaged, and client expectations are consistently met.

Position Summary
Hosts are responsible for greeting guests, taking reservations, answering questions, managing wait times, and escorting guests to the dining and bar areas. At all times, hosts are expected to be attentive to guests' needs, make them feel welcome, comfortable, important and relaxed. Hosts know their demeanor and actions represent the winery and they are to provide a quality experience for guests. Hosts work in close collaboration with colleagues and must adhere to established health and safety standards. Hosts help maintain the cleanliness, presentation and ambiance of the winery and restrooms, which is an integral part of the guests' experience. Hosts are also expected to work coat check shifts for private events.
Responsibilities
Guest Engagement & Hospitality
  • Greet guests as soon as they enter the winery
  • Manage the flow of guests in the seating to ensure even workloads for Tasting Room staff
  • Provide guests with accurate wait time estimates during busy periods
  • Address guest concerns promptly, politely and positively
  • Contribute to event growth by creating goodwill with guests
  • Have a high level understanding of the food and beverage menus
  • Be comfortable with extreme weather during service of outside dining areas

Event Space Readiness & Maintenance
  • Maintain a neat, organized front-of-house environment
  • Assist with opening/closing tasks and side work as needed, including polishing glassware and silverware and folding napkins
  • Perform light housekeeping duties such as cleaning windows and restrooms

Team Support
  • Attend meetings and trainings as requested, including pre-shift meetings
  • Assist with training and mentoring of new staff

Guest Relations & Administrative Duties
  • Answer phones and schedule small party reservations
  • Direct large party reservations to the Manager on duty
  • manage coat check for large scale events and weddings
  • Other duties as required

Health, Safety and Event Standards
  • Adhere to grooming, conduct and uniform standards
  • Abide by sanitation, health and company guidelines concerning safety, cleanliness, safe food handling and alcoholic beverages
